Membrane separations
Xampler laboratory membrane cartridges GE Healthcare Xampler™ ultrafiltration and microfiltration cartridges are designed for laboratory scale processing, with typical volumes ranging from a few hundred mls to about 10 liters of solution. Xampler cartridges are offered with nominal flowpath lengths of 30 and 60 cm and membrane areas ranging from 110 to 1,400 cm2 (0.12 to 1.5 ft2). They are directly scalable to GE Healthcare 30- and 60-cm pilot and process scale cartridges. Xampler cartridges have fully self-contained housings and are well-suited for use with GE Healthcare’s QuixStand™ benchtop system. When operated in a vertical orientation complete process fluid drainage and maximum product recovery is achieved. Xampler hollow fiber cartridges are offered with mini Tri-Clamp® end fittings for quick and easy sanitary connection to your laboratory equipment. These cartridges are identified with an “M” in the suffix of the model number. A select portion of the Xampler line is also offered with barbed end fittings for simple flexible tubing connection. Schematic diagrams showing the alternative cartridge sizes and end fittings are provided in Figure 4. All GE Healthcare Xampler microfiltration cartridges are autoclavable. Moreover, all Xampler ultrafiltration cartridges are autoclavable with the exception of 1,000 Dalton nominal molecular weight cutoff (NMWC) membrane units. An “A” as the model number suffix signifies that the particular cartridge may be autoclaved.

Xampler cartridge features and benefits Versatile • Nominal flowpath lengths of 30 and 60 cm facilitate optimization of process conditions and assist future scale-up • Membrane areas from 110 to 1,400 cm2 (0.12 to 1.5 ft2) suit specific processing needs • UF pore sizes range from 1 kD to 750 kD NMWC • MF pore sizes range from 0.1 to 0.65 micron
Designed for the laboratory • Low flow rate requirements allow use of smaller pumps • Polysulfone membrane minimizes non-specific protein binding and provides high product recovery • Autoclavable (with the exception of 1,000 NMWC) devices address the need for small-volume sanitary processing
Easy to use • Self-contained housings with translucent polysulfone shells allow ease of installation and provide a visual observation of the membrane separation process • Offered with Tri-Clamp end fittings for quick and easy aseptic connection
Typical applications • Clarification of lysates and cell cultures • Concentration, diafiltration, and purification of monoclonal antibodies, plasmids, proteins, viruses, vaccines, colloids, and plasma
GE Healthcare QuixStand benchtop system The QuixStand benchtop system is a compact, easy to use laboratory-scale separations system that uses Xampler cartridges for quick and efficient concentration and diafiltration of a wide range of biological solutions. The QuixStand system is capable of rapidly processing solution volumes up to 10 liters. QuixStand systems can be purchased with or without pumps, and are available in non-sanitary, sanitary, and autoclavable versions.

GE Healthcare hollow fiber membrane The outstanding performance of GE Healthcare hollow fiber products is based on a proprietary manufacturing process that yields membrane with a structure free of macrovoids and pinhole defects associated with conventional hollow fiber membranes. Separation processes which incorporate a defect-free membrane can use broader operating parameters without compromising membrane performance or integrity.
